how about recognizing that bicycle specific protections from bikes FRAP laws are more permissive for bicyclists than general SMV FRAP laws, and that a removal of these protections would lead to greater restrictions on cyclists.

Mandatory bikelane and shoulder use laws should be fought against. luckily there are in only a handful of states.

Bikeways planning needs to follow and develop in the directions 21st century design guidance (federal or states, barry) already has.

Build better bikeways along emphasized transportation corridors in communities so as to facilitate populist bicycling.

Plan for roadway bicycling on all roads except those bicyclists are prohibited.

Plan for all of the public rather than just the traffic tolerant 'expert' cyclists in a community, as they are both traffic tolerant and will always be the extreme minority.
